The “tusk like teeth” are called incisors! These belong to a rodent, likely a squirrel given the size of the bone. Rodent incisors are continuously growing during the life of the animal. This is why the go on for so long and extend deep into the mandibles. When the tissue dries up when a bone is left out in the sun, there’s nothing holding teeth in place anymore so these incisors can slide in and out. When the animal is alive these are fixed in place and slowly erode over time. As they erode and wear down, they push forward and replace the eroded material.

Most of these mandibles have been broken so the coronoid and angular processes are no longer present.

That's just who John was. I also tend to think he was his biggest critic. John has always been one to critique and bash his former self, as a way to prop himself up in the present. He did it with tons of his songs. He called "And Your Bird Can Sing", "It's Only Love", "Yes It Is" trash and hated how "Strawberry Fields Forever" came out. Essentially, if he's talking about how awful something he did was, it must mean he's grown leaps and bounds and is much smarter/better now. Sort of a weird ethos builder by destroying his past self. I think him being so open about him being a bad father to Julian and husband to Cynthia was his attempt at showcasing that he was in the present a better version.
